Likewise, people ask, can you open bread machine while kneading? So many people seem afraid to “interfere” with their bread machine as it works. But honestly, nothing bad will happen if you open the lid and poke at the dough. Start watching the dough about 10 minutes into its kneading cycle; it shouldn’t be viscous and liquid-like (top), nor dry, stiff, and “gnarly” (bottom).

How do I reset my Panasonic Bread Maker?

In order to reset the breadmaker and erase any program set, just remove the mains plug from the wall socket or turn the socket off, (if it is a switched socket), Then wait for more than 15 minutes before plugging back in (or switching it back on). When the display comes back on you can set the new program.

How long can you delay a bread machine?

Most bread machines have a delayed cycle allowing you to load ingredients for a final bread cycle up to 13 hours later. But there’s a catch. You can load ingredients into your bread pan and pre-set your bread machine to knead, rise and bake a loaf up to 13 hours in advance.

What does rest mean on a Panasonic Bread Maker?

The rest period lets the bread pan and its contents warm up to the right temperature. This is an important step if you keep flour and yeast in the fridge or freezer. After resting, the bread machine will continue mixing and kneading the ingredients.

What is quick bread setting on bread machine?

Quick/Rapid

Use this setting for baking 2 lbs. bread quickly – the time is slightly longer than Express Bake but the texture will be finer. The loaves baked with this setting are a little taller and airier than the 58-minute bread.

Why does my bread machine say rest?

This is part of the Baking process. This rest period allows for better absorption of water and helps the gluten and starches to align. It is a way to reduce kneading time and thereby improve the flavour and colour of the bread. This can take up to 1 hour and 30 minutes, depending on the program selected.

Why is my bread machine bread not rising?

Too little yeast, your bread won’t rise sufficiently; too much, and it will rise and collapse. … The basic ratio of salt to flour in bread is 1/2 teaspoon salt per cup of flour. Recipes that call for less salt than this may seem “blah”; try increasing the amount of salt to the recommended ratio.
